Abstract

The utility model relates to a metallic and soft rubbing huller type rice mill which comprises a hopper, a circular roller and a machine frame. At least one roller which is parallel with a shaft is arranged around the circular roller. Both ends of the roller are fixed. The space which is remained between the circular roller and the roller is a rice milling chamber. A feeding passage of the hopper is communicated with the rice milling chamber. A discharging passage is arranged at the bottom part of the rice milling chamber. The roller is formed by that blades are mutually inlaid and arranged in parallel in a frame of the roller. One side of the frame of the roller is open; therefore, the blades are exposed. The exposed ends of the blades are upward bent in the mode of a curve to form at least one sharp tooth. Elastic and soft articles are arranged between the ends of the blades, which are built in the frame of the roller, and the frame of the roller. The utility model adopts a special metallic soft rubbing structure to carry out shelling and peeling for paddies. The utility model has the advantages of high shelling rate, high rate of whole rice, reservation of embryonic buds of the rice, durability and wear resistance.

Description

The soft friction rice huller of metal rice mill
The utility model belongs to the Cereals Processing Machines field, is specifically related to a kind ofly paddy is processed into the metal buffing that nutritious high-quality rice with remained germ uses wipes the rice huller rice mill.
At present, on the paddy process technology, generally adopt rubber roll rice huller paddy, earlier paddy is processed into brown rice, again brown rice is processed into rice in rice mill then.Rubber roll husker is that a kind of rubber buffing is wiped, though it has the head rice yield height, and the advantage that husking yield is high, it is not wear-resisting, and heating is expanded easily, therefore, often wants shutdown inspection to change, and shortcoming such as rubber pollution in addition.And rice mill is nothing but to adopt the pressure friction and grind the mode of cutting, and power consumption is high, the height of cracking rice, and original plumule is all broken away to fall on the rice, and plumule is the important component part of rice, and the nutritional labeling major part is all in plumule, so nutritive loss is big.
The utility model is at the prior art above shortcomings, and purpose provides a kind of soft friction structure of special metal that adopts paddy is shelled, removes the peel, the husking yield height, and the head rice yield height keeps the rice plumule, the soft friction rice huller of the metal of durable wear rice mill.
The technical solution of the utility model is as follows:
The soft friction of metal rice huller rice mill comprises being positioned at the hopper on top the hopper bottom and being ground by the circle that axle drives that circle grinds and is positioned on the frame, grinds and parallel at least one roller of establishing with axle around circle, and the roller two ends are fixed, and circle to leave the space between grinding be the husk rice chamber.The feeding-passage of hopper is connected the husk rice chamber between circle stone roller and the roller, and end bottom in husk rice chamber sets out the material passage.Roller is arranged in the roller frame by the parallel edge mutually of blade, and the roller frame opens wide on one side and exposes blade, and blade exposes that an end is curved to upwarp, and forms at least one sharp-pointed tooth, and blade is built in and establishes the soft thing of elasticity between roller frame one end and the roller frame.
The circle of the soft friction rice huller of this metal rice mill grinds and roller can vertically be settled also and can laterally settle.The roller two ends are fixed by Spring screws.A plurality of rollers can be formed a roller group, between every roller composition and the hopper independently feeding-passage are arranged, and independently tapping channel is arranged at the bottom, cuts off mutually between the roller group.
The utility model has the advantages that:
1. adopt the roller of forming by metal blade, and establish elasticity thing pad in the blade bottom and make the contact-making surface of roller sharp and soft, but both high efficiency shells, and guarantee the head rice yield height again, and frictional heat is minimum, durable wear, fault rate is low.
2. many group rollers can be set as required, and every group of roller independently finished shelling, and peeling is until go out a meter full process, husk rice efficient height.
3. because the friction gap between circle stone roller and the roller can be regulated according to the granular size of cereal, making cereal is the axle center rotation with two ends when being ground mostly, thereby retains a meter plumule.

Embodiment: referring to Fig. 1, Fig. 2 and Fig. 3, this machine divides four roller groups, and bucket cap 2 is arranged at the bottom of hopper 1, and four breach are divided equally at bucket cap 2 edges, and the effect of bucket cap 2 is to make paddy flow to each breach smoothly, enters 3 li of little buckets, and little bucket 3 taps into material passage 4.Hopper 1 bottom is established circle and is ground 19, drive by axle 9, circle is rolled over 19 and is positioned on the frame 10, grind 19 and parallelly with axle 9 establish 12 rollers 6 around circle, roller 6 two ends are fixed on the frame 10 by the screw 11 of band spring 12, the degree of tightness nut just can be regulated the distance between roller and the circle stone roller, thereby reaches the different-effect that rice huller grinds.Leaving the space between roller 6 and circle grind 19 is husk rice chamber 5, and feeding-passage 4 connects husk rice chamber 5, and 5 terminal bottoms, husk rice chamber set out material passage 7, and husk rice chamber 5 one sides are that circle grinds 19, and one side is a knee wall 13, and being close to is roller 6.What rollers are a husk rice group have, and what knee walls 13 are just arranged, and knee wall 13 is connected as a whole with frame 10, also are to grind for 19 1 weeks around circle.Feeding-passage 4 is adjacent with the tapping channel 7 of another roller group, but is separated by, and feeding-passage 4 has only with the roller chamber 5 of side unimpeded.
Referring to Fig. 4,5, roller 6 is by several blade 14 parallel being set in mutually in the roller frame 18, roller frame 18 opens wide on one side and exposes blade 14, blade 14 exposes that an end is curved to upwarp, form two sharp-pointed teeth 15, blade 14 is built in roller frame 18 1 ends, and establishes flexible pipe 16 or cushion bar 17 between the roller frame 18.When individual blade 14 is squeezed, its can be gone down by depression, if extruding disappears, it recovers original position again.Though so individual blade is hard, soft on the whole, high resilience, the soft friction of metallic elastic that Here it is.
Referring to Fig. 6, horizontal hulling machine structure is simpler, and circle stone roller 19 is horizontal with roller 6, is supported by frame 10, and roller 6 two ends are connected on the frame 10 with screw 11, and screw has spring 12.Parbuckle screw is adjustable pitch circle grind 19 and roller 6 between the gap.Can obtain processing different effects.
More than two kinds of rice huller rice mills working condition as follows:
Vertical rice huller rice mill, paddy enters hopper 1, falls into several little buckets 3 again respectively, enters feed space 4.When circle grinds under 19 the drivings at power, paddy is laterally sent into husk rice chamber 5, paddy is subjected to the soft friction of roller 6 immediately.Paddy soft friction for the first time shells mostly, and does not hinder the grain of rice, and the grain of rice is again to be that the axle rotation is rubbed with two ends, and plumule remains.And then enter second roller 6 and rub, paddy grinds 19 grind and cut down at the friction of several rollers 6 and circle like this, and shelling is gone roughly, and pearling is delivered in the tapping channel 7 at last.The grain of rice and chaff skin fall in the collection bucket 8, and this is the process of a roller group.Four roller groups of vertical rice huller rice mill ground for 19 1 weeks around middle circle, finished the work of oneself separately.Rice and chaff that last each husk rice group processes all fall in the collection bucket 8, and it is separated to enter next operation.
Horizontal hulling machine: paddy enters hopper 1, vertically fall into circle grind 19 with roller 6 between, circle grinds 19 and rotated by power drive, paddy is being subjected to the soft friction of dried roller 6 and circle very soon and is grinding 19 and grind and cut, shelling immediately falls in the collection bucket 8, enters next procedure.
